The first production Eurocopter EC 225 medium twin made its maiden flight in late June. Eurocopter said the “flawless” event lasted just over two hours. The EC 225 is powered by two Turbomeca Makila 2A modular turboshafts, an engine that has just been certified by the European Aviation Safety Agency (EASA). Each of the powerplants generates 2,413 shp in contingency mode–14 percent more than the previous model. The modular feature makes for easier inspection and maintenance, and the FADEC, with dual duplex channels, offers “the highest level” of reliability.

The first production engines conforming to the certified standard were due to be delivered at press time. Production is now geared to the delivery of 14 military EC 725 variants to the French Air Force over the next 16 months. The first delivery of the civil EC 225, to the UK’s Bristow Helicopters, is expected next July.
